INSTRUCTIONS FOR USE: INFORMATION FOR THE USER
Larynx comp., Globuli velati
Composition:
10 g of Globuli velati contain: Larynx bovis Gl Dil. D5 0.1 g (HAB, Vs. 41b), Levisticum officinale e radice ferm 33c Dil. D5 0.1 g (HAB, Vs. 33c), Nervus laryngeus recurrens bovis Gl Dil. D5 0.1 g (HAB, Vs. 41a), Nervus laryngeus superior bovis Gl Dil. D5 0.1 g (HAB, Vs. 41a), Nervus vagus bovis Gl Dil. D5 0.1 g (HAB, Vs. 41a). Contains sucrose (sucrose/sugar).
Indications:
According to the anthroposophical understanding of man and nature. These include: stimulation and harmonization of speech organization, e.g., vocal cord weakness, chronic laryngitis.
Contraindications:
None known.
Precautions for use and warnings:
This medicine contains sucrose. Please only take Larynx comp. after consulting your doctor if you know that you suffer from an intolerance to certain sugars.
Dosage and method of administration:
Unless otherwise prescribed:
- Children under 6 years: Dissolve 3 to 5 Globuli velati under the tongue 3 to 5 times daily.
- Adults and children from 6 years: Dissolve 5 to 10 Globuli velati under the tongue 3 to 5 times daily.
Duration of use:
The duration of treatment for chronic diseases requires consultation with a physician.
Side effects:
None known.
